We Went to War

A Army Combat Chaplain's Deployment to Afghanistan with the 173rd Airborne Brigade

We Went to War takes readers inside a nine-month combat deployment to Afghanistan with the paratroopers of the 2nd Battalion, 503rd Parachute Infantry Regiment—"The Rock"—of the 173rd Airborne Brigade Combat Team.

Tom Latham deployed with them as their battalion chaplain, moving between forward operating bases and remote combat outposts during one of the most dangerous periods of the war. The deployment brought small-arms fire, rockets, mortars, IEDs, suicide attacks, casualties, and the constant knowledge that the next mission could change everything.

But this is more than a story about combat. It is about the men who fought the war, the friendships formed between them, the families waiting at home, and a chaplain trying to care for soldiers while living through the same dangers they faced.

Written largely from memories and material recorded during the deployment itself, We Went to War is a firsthand account of courage, brotherhood, faith, loss, and what daily life was really like inside America's war in Afghanistan.
